What materials currently compete with cork?
Depending on the field of application, we find different materials that can compete with cork. For example, in the case of electric mobility, the most commonly-used materials for thermal management and sealing are silicone sponges, polyurethane foams and ceramic materials (micas). Cork as a damping material
Due to its closed, cellular structure, filled with air, cork has a higher loss factor than rubber, which is essential for damping and consequent energy dissipation. Our specific polymer formulations and the addition of cork, with its unique compressibility and recovery features, enhance the material’s high loss factor.…

Natural Frequency
All anti-vibration pads/materials, components and systems have a natural frequency (fn). In case of the anti-vibration pad the natural frequency, fn, is dependent upon the stiffness of the pad material, K, and the mass of the load that it is supporting (M). In elastomeric materials the fn is not only defined by the act…

Mid-sole
The part of the shoe between the very bottom and where the foot rests. The midsole is a cushioning layer between the outsole and the upper. Various rubber and foam compounds are used for shock absorption. Generally, heavier-weight materials will be firmer and more durable.

Cork composites for high performance
While cork has a higher loss factor than rubber – which is essential to the dampening function and consequent dissipation of energy – anti-vibration rubbers are isolative and offer very little damping. The combination of these two materials as a cork rubber composite brings added characteristics as a vibration isolatio…

IIC values
IIC values are not heavily influenced by the presence of mass in the structure. A 6” solid concrete slab, for example, has an IIC rating of about 28, without underlayment or flooring materials installed. Wood frame assemblies, without a sound mat or flooring installed typically have IIC ratings around 30. These ratings…
